The ingredients needed to prepare Idli Sambar:
- Get 2 cups sela rice
- Use 3/4 cup urad dal dhuli
- Take 1/2 cup poha
- Prepare 1/2 cup cooked rice
- You need 1 teaspoon salt or to taste
- You need 1/2 teaspoon methi seeds
- Get 3 table spoon Sambar powder
- Provide 1 bowl toor dal
- Provide 1 teaspoon Salt or to taste
- You need 2 cups chopped Vegetables like ripe pumpkin, bottle gourd, carrot, french beans, drum sticks, tomato and onion
- Provide 2 teaspoon imli pulp
- Get For tempering
- Use 1 teaspoon mustard seeds
- Use 8-10 curry leaves
- Take 2 dry whole red chillies
Steps to make Idli Sambar:
- Soak rice, methi seeds and urad dal separately in water for 4 hours
- Take out from the water and grind properly in the grinder separately to a smooth paste, while grinding mix cooked rice and poha.
- After grinding, mix the batters and add salt and keep at room temperature for 6 hours.
- Next day the batter is fermented, mix lightly and pour a ladle full of batter in each of the cavities of the idli stand.
- Then use idli steamer and steam for 10 minutes to make the fluffy spongy Idlis.
- For the sambar-Wash and soak the toor dal for one hour
- Pressure cook the dal with a teaspoon of salt and all vegetables for about 3 whistles.
- Switch off the gas and let the pressure release by itself.
- In the meantime heat 2 teaspoon of oil for tempering and add curry leaves, mustard seeds and dry whole red chillies
- Add this tempering, tamarind pulp and sambhar masala in the sambhar, cook for 5 minutes bring to a boil and it's ready to serve.
- Serve hot fluffy idlis with hot and spicy sambar
